Allright,
I was a firm believer that injector cleaner was injector cleaner. Some brands were better than others, yatta, yatta, yatta. Last Monday I had stopped by Autorolla to chat with Hugh and Harv. During our discussion they had pointed out this stuff called Liqui Moly Jector. They had told me that this stuff is absoloutly incredible and that they have people calling them with in 10 min of using it saying how wonderfull this stuff works. Well me being the skeptic that I am, I had decided to buy some and try it out. I figure I would run it in my Sentra, that way in the event that this thing blows my motor it is not a big deal.
Now I had just finished pouring it into my tank and decided to take a drive home as I lived about 10 min away in heavy traffic. The first 5 min was going by and I had felt nor noticed anything. I was figuring ah.. just another injector cleaner that is supposed to be good. Well at around the 9 min mark, I had decided to rev it up and go through 1,2 and D. While I was doing this I felt something happening. I felt as if my car was beginning to transform into a beast. It would pull through the RPM's but there were some spots where there would be a sudden burst of power, then normal driving. So yes, it felt like it was hesitating compared to what I was used to driving. The more i drove it the more power I was feeling. By this time 10 min had passed. I figure I would take it down a quick rip down the freeway "just to see". So 15 min later, my car accelerated much quicker, my fuel milage has increased. (to give an acurate figure I can not as I was not doing my normal driving habits on this tank).
Now the question is would I reccomend this stuff? Well to give you an idea, I went back the next day and bought some for my Supra, same results, and bought 2 more cans. Again similar results. So yes, I reccomend buying this.
Now the Specs:
Liqui Moly Jector
300 ml Can
The can comes with a nossel that you screw on to the cap for easy pouring and no spills. Very inventive
Price non club price is around $11.00 I think. Club price is about $8.00. I do not have the bill in front of me
You do not need to pour into an empty tank and then fill for it to be effective. I poured mine into a full tank of fuel. It mixes perfectly with your fuel and the Jector will dissolve any deposits and residue on your injectors.
1 300ml bottle will treat an entire tank of fuel.
